My friend just delivery of his GT3.2 and took me out for a ride at full throttle. Wow what a car but not crazy loud. Last weekend at a track even I went out with another friend in his GT3.1 with the GMG exhaust and it is clearly much louder than than OEM on the GT3.2. The GMG sounds more like the iPe video above. While I believe the GT3.2 is slightly louder than previous OEM version it's no where near the "violent" sound of the GMG. Remember the OEM exhaust for the most part will pass sound checks at most tracks whereas the GMG will NOT pass many in our area with 92db limits. (If you want to run GMG at certain tracks you will need to manually close the exhaust valves so they don't open under high rpm's.) What a sound though.
